Adw Art

When it rains it pours

Description

This piece by ADW Art defines the fight in Dublin for the right to paint our walls with beauty. The #greyareaproject is a campaign led by a collective of Ireland's most-talented street artists who are successfully bringing the council's reaction to public art forms into the public  domain.  The artist's want the city to glow in the colours of creativity while the council want the walls painted grey. With pieces like this lighting up our streetscape, this argument seems redundant.
